Aspen's blankets are finding their way into jackets as well. You could use two or three millimeters in a jacket and replace a significant volume of down, to have something much leaner and body-forming, ... There's also interesting work going on to perhaps address firefighter suits. The dream there is instead of 35 pounds of vulcanized rubber, you have something with more freedom and less weight so they can do their jobs.
